You can see the digester Feeding tubes in the patch. The sun heats these up great and helps quickly breakdown sugars and helps with the natural nitrogen numbers. They are perferated at the bottoms and filled with sugars, Calsiums, Nitrats (all Disolved solids type), Wine, Sunny D,(sowered) Sweet Horse Feed, Eggs and shells detergents, river moss, emulsified fish matter, emulsified goat manure and believe me much much more lol. I've exploded more than what I have growing because of too much heat growth. I can regulate the temp. at fermintation to the rate of how much food detention time is at the root base along with PH and sometimes I get greedy lol
